U.N. Cybersecurity Arm Endorses EC-Council's Global CyberLympics
Aug 4, 2011 | ALBUQUERQUE, NM - The cybersecurity executing arm of the United Nations has endorsed the Global CyberLympics, a new initiative by the EC-Council to foster stronger international cooperation on information security issues and to improve cybersecurity training and awareness in developing nations and third world countries.
Enterprise Log Management: An Overview (Part 1) - - FOSE
Log management is the collection of self-generated data from IT hardware devices and software applications. The collection of this data can contain useful information about business processes such as the number of errors on a website or even a security issue that displays the number of failed attempts to access a perimeter router.
